Last night, our community gathered for a second time in unity across Rhode Island for a powerful time of prayer and agreement.
We stood together believing for protection and restoration over families, first responders, our healthcare system, and our education system. We continued to intercede for all those affected by the Pawtucket Ice Rink shooting, lifting up every individual, family, and leader impacted by this tragedy in Pawtucket.
A sister in Christ and victim advocate, I’Loner Weaver, joined us and shared insight into the deep and often unseen hardships faced by victims of violent crimes. Practical resources were provided, including information about state advocacy groups and a faith-based counseling service currently accepting clients. We are grateful for tangible help alongside prayer.
